Abstract

Pemrosesan citra digital adalah bidang yang berkembang pesat dalam ilmu komputer dan teknologi informasi. Tujuannya adalah untuk meningkatkan kualitas gambar, mengekstrak informasi berguna, dan melakukan analisis kompleks yang tidak dapat dilakukan secara manual. Salah satu teknik dasar pengolahan citra adalah Thresholding. Hal ini bertujuan untuk memisahkan objek dari latar belakang dengan mengubah gambar menjadi gambar biner. Jurnal ini menjelaskan implementasi program pengolahan citra digital menggunakan Python dan OpenCV dengan menerapkan tiga teknik ambang batas: Global, Adaptif (Average), dan Adaptif (Gaussian). Kami juga menyajikan metode pengurangan noise yang menggunakan keburaman rata rata sebelum menerapkan ambang batas. Proses implementasinya dilakukan dengan membaca gambar dalam mode skala abu-abu, mereduksi noise dan menerapkan berbagai teknik ambang batas. Hasil dari masing-masing metode dievaluasi dan dibandingkan, dan efektivitasnya dalam memisahkan objek dari latar belakang dianalisis.

Abstract

The aim of this research is to design a basic food sales information system at CV. Java-based Ferdi to assist employee performance in processing purchasing and sales data. This system is designed to increase the efficiency and effectiveness of store operations by utilizing information technology. Researchers conducted field studies to understand the shop's business processes in depth, starting from collecting data on goods, ordering to suppliers, to the sales process to customers. Apart from that, researchers also conducted interviews with employees and shop owners to identify system needs. Based on the results of the needs analysis, the researcher designed a system database in the form of interconnected tables to support system functions. The system is designed using the Java programming language with the waterfall method to facilitate system development and maintenance in the future. The main function of the system includes inputting master data such as goods, suppliers and employee data. There is also a module for carrying out sales transactions and ordering goods from suppliers online. Apart from that, there are reports that can be generated by the system such as sales reports, stock of goods, and financial reports for easy business analysis by shop owners. Test results show the system is able to meet business needs and can increase employee productivity.
